Ingredients
For the Meatballs
1 lb ground beef
1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
1 tsp dried Italian seasoning
For the Pasta
8 oz linguine pasta
For the Garlic Butter Sauce
4 tbsp unsalted butter
4 cloves garlic, minced
Salt and pepper to taste
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)

How to Make Garlic Butter Meatballs Over Creamy Parmesan Linguine
Step 1: Prepare the Meatball Mixture
In a large mixing bowl, combine ground beef, grated Parmesan cheese, dried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.
Mix well until all ingredients are thoroughly combined.
Step 2: Form the Meatballs
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
Roll the mixture into small balls (about 1 inch in diameter) and place them on a baking sheet.
Step 3: Bake the Meatballs
Bake in the preheated oven for about 20 minutes or until fully cooked through and browned on the outside.
Step 4: Cook the Linguine
While the meatballs are baking, bring a pot of salted water to a boil.
Add linguine pasta and cook according to package instructions until al dente.
Drain the pasta and set aside.
Step 5: Make the Garlic Butter Sauce
In a skillet over medium heat, melt butter.
Add minced garlic and sauté until fragrant (about 1 minute).
Season with salt and pepper.
Step 6: Combine Everything
Add cooked meatballs to the skillet with garlic butter sauce.
Toss gently to coat each meatball in sauce.
Serve over creamy parmesan linguine, garnishing with fresh parsley if desired.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Ignoring seasoning: Not seasoning your meatballs properly can lead to bland flavors. Make sure to add salt, pepper, and herbs generously before cooking.
Overcooking the pasta: Cooking linguine for too long can make it mushy. Always follow the package instructions and taste it a minute or two before the suggested time.
Using cold ingredients: Starting with cold ground beef may cause uneven cooking. Let your beef sit at room temperature for about 15 minutes before mixing and shaping.
Not letting the sauce thicken: If you rush the sauce, it may not develop the rich flavor you desire. Allow it to simmer gently until creamy.
Skipping rest time for meatballs: Cutting into meatballs straight from the pan can let out juices. Let them rest for a few minutes to keep them moist.
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
Store in airtight containers for up to 3 days.
Ensure that both meatballs and linguine are cooled before sealing.
Freezing Garlic Butter Meatballs Over Creamy Parmesan Linguine
Freeze for up to 2 months in freezer-safe containers.
Label containers with the date for easy tracking.
Reheating Garlic Butter Meatballs Over Creamy Parmesan Linguine
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C), cover with foil, and heat for about 20-25 minutes.
Microwave: Use medium power, heat in short bursts of 1-2 minutes, stirring occasionally until warmed through.
Stovetop: In a skillet over low heat, stir occasionally until warmed evenly.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the best way to serve Garlic Butter Meatballs Over Creamy Parmesan Linguine?
Serving garlic butter meatballs over creamy parmesan linguine pairs well with a side salad and crusty bread for a complete meal.
Can I use different types of pasta for this recipe?
Absolutely! While linguine works great, feel free to use spaghetti, fettuccine, or any pasta you prefer.
How can I customize Garlic Butter Meatballs Over Creamy Parmesan Linguine?
You can add vegetables like spinach or mushrooms to the linguine or swap out beef for turkey or chicken if desired.
Can I prepare this dish ahead of time?
Yes! You can make the meatballs and sauce ahead of time and store them separately until you’re ready to cook the pasta.
Is it possible to make this recipe gluten-free?
Certainly! Use gluten-free pasta options available in stores, and ensure all other ingredients are gluten-free as well.
